当前位置: 首页 > news >正文

php做投票网站沪浙网站

php做投票网站,沪浙网站,建立网站官网,虚拟主机怎么用一.题目 P1550 [USACO08OCT] Watering Hole G - 洛谷 | 计算机科学教育新生态 (luogu.com.cn) 二.分析 1.我们是要使所有的农场都要有水 2.可以从起点引水#xff0c;也可以互相引水。 3.费用要最小 这时我们可以想到最小生成树#xff0c;建立一个虚拟节点即可。思路一…一.题目 P1550 [USACO08OCT] Watering Hole G - 洛谷 | 计算机科学教育新生态 (luogu.com.cn) 二.分析 1.我们是要使所有的农场都要有水 2.可以从起点引水也可以互相引水。 3.费用要最小 这时我们可以想到最小生成树建立一个虚拟节点即可。思路一目了然。 三.参考代码 #includebits/stdc.h #define maxn 91000 using namespace std; struct Edge{int u,v,w; }edge[maxn]; int n,cnt; int fa[305]; int find(int x){return xfa[x] ? x :fa[x]find(fa[x]); } void merge(int x,int y){int fxfind(x),fyfind(y);fa[fx]fy; } bool cmp(Edge a,Edge b){return a.wb.w; } long long ans; void kruskal(){sort(edge1,edgecnt1,cmp);int tot0;for(int i1;icnt;i){int xedge[i].u,yedge[i].v;if(find(x)find(y)) continue;tot;ansedge[i].w;merge(x,y);if(totn) return;} } int main(){scanf(%d,n);int w;for(int i1;in;i){scanf(%d,w);edge[cnt](Edge){0,i,w};}for(int i1;in;i){for(int j1;jn;j){scanf(%d,w);if(w!0){edge[cnt](Edge){i,j,w};}}}for(int i1;in;i) fa[i]i;kruskal();coutans;return 0; }四.总结 当看到这些条件可以想到最小生成树 1.涉及到每个节点 2.最小/最大的值 3.一般都要用到虚拟节点以处理初始点
http://www.hkea.cn/news/14390343/

相关文章:

  • 景山网站建设公司网站程序风格
  • 咸阳学校网站建设公司公司网站制作哪家公司好
  • python wordpress建站一个完整的网站建设
  • 江津网站建设上海大学生兼职做网站
  • 秦皇岛做网站的公司选汉狮嘉兴网站建设维护
  • 怎么做网站和艺龙对接重庆企业建站模板
  • 免费不良正能量网站链接网站设计技术有哪些
  • 河间米各庄网站建设制作纵横天下网站建设
  • 网站优化软件下载注册永久免费域名
  • 深圳设计品牌网站工业设计网站免费
  • 网站建设负责那内容上传吗淘宝图片做链接的网站
  • 广东省优质高职院校建设网站百度推广话术全流程
  • c 小说网站开发教程企业微信app开发
  • 江苏商城网站制作公司互联网保险发展现状
  • 网站添加定位怎么做玖玖玖人力资源有限公司
  • 网站优化 英文wordpress博客伪静态
  • 医院网站加快建设方案阿里云快速建站教程
  • 合肥市建设工程合同备案网站网站部署步骤网站开发
  • 罗湖商城网站建设哪家技术好网站微信二维码侧边栏漂浮框
  • 从seo角度去建设网站网站的开发是使用什么技术
  • 制作宝安网站建设c .net 做网站
  • 排版设计模板免费seo岗位有哪些
  • 做的网站怎才能被别人访问到如何建设大型电子商务网站
  • 网站设计不包括插画师零基础自学
  • 山东网站营销推广费用大气学校网站
  • 微商自己做网站宜兴网站开发
  • 网站图片 原则企业网站的搭建流程
  • 网站编辑没有经验可以做吗电商网站销售数据分析
  • 网站快速排名优化报价网站优化锚文本链接之精髓
  • 本地部署iis部署网站网站建设ui